Json模式django rest框架,将json字段描述为json而不是字符串

时间:2019-06-21 09:43:29

标签: django-rest-framework jsonschema django-rest-swagger

我在DRF中有一个Api,用张扬地描述。 在我的序列化器中,我有一个像这样的字段:

settings = serializers.DictField(child=serializers.JSONField())

是否有可能在swagger.json中将该字段描述为'Json'而不是字符串:

"additionalProperties": {
            "type": "string"
}

但是

"additionalProperties": {
        "type": "JSON"
}

1 个答案:

答案 0 :(得分:4)

对不起,这不是JSON模式所能实现的。

类型是JSON允许的原始类型。